Our goal is to enrich the cultural life of the region and, in so doing, add to the common experience that bonds us all to our community and the world around us. We explore various cultures and common values in the hope of strengthening an appreciation for diversity and promoting a sense of community on the Front Range of the Rocky Mountains. The Theatre provides a venue in which writers, directors

, actors, designers, poets, and visual artists can practice and improve their craft as well as experiment and develop new creative works.

TODAY!!! We have a matinee of MR BURNS at 2:30!! Join us for the play that features TV's favorite cartoon family, and the evolution of storytelling.

The grid has failed, society has crumbled, and to hold back the darkness, a ragtag group of strangers gather around a campfire to recreate their vanished world through the life-affirming act of storytelling. Whether you’ve never seen The Simpsons or you know every episode by heart, you will be electrified by this love letter to live theatre and hymn to survival and resilience.

Mr. Burns is an exhilarating exploration of how the pop culture of one era might evolve into the mythology of another.

There will be singing and dancing and fire and poison and jazz hands and Sideshow Bob and crocodiles and piranhas and passion and pageantry and Gilbert and Sullivan and darkness and devastation. But when all hope is lost - there will be Bart.

MR. BURNS, written by Anne Washburn and directed by Steve Keim, runs weekends September 19 - October 12. Friday and Saturday at 7:30, and Sundays at 2:30.

Meet Bruce Gammonley. Bruce plays Matt and Homer. We asked Bruce the following questions:

How do you relate to your characters?
Like Matt, I am a big Simpsons fan and enjoy bonding with others over TV and other media.

Do you have a favorite moment from rehearsal?
Hearing Act III come together really brought a whole new sense of power and energy to the show!

How do you connect to your characters?
Creating a person history and graphic of their relationships to the other characters helps solidify who they are.

What is the biggest challenge about performing in this show?
Each act of the show is such a different animal. Even within each scene there are a number of emotional turns that present a real challenge.

What motivates your characters?
Matt is motivated by a desperate desire to return to some semblance of society. His Life is defines by connection to others and he pursues this through shared media.
Home is a warm protector of his family (unlike in The Simpsons). He tries to find the best in every scenario, and represents hope for a better future.

Without giving anything away, what is your favorite line of dialogue?
"I think he's talking to you."

Besides yourself, which actor in this production is going to blow people away?
Brett's Mr. Burns is oozing with camp and malice.

If you could play any other role in the show, who would it be?
Each of the characters are so interesting! Ann Washburn's script is so unique that playing each of the characters is a pleasure!

It is time to meet the Cast. Meet Trisha Gillin. Trisha plays Colleen/Lisa. We asked Trisha the following questions:

How do you relate to your characters?
Like Colleen, I also have trauma and won't take s**t from anyone. I'm also a parent and used to wrangling pre-teens, which is a lot like managing actors.

Do you have a favorite moment from rehearsal?
I've loved how well everyone works together and how we've all been developing our characters and their relationships, and feeding off each other. It's been very collaborative , and everyone has had great insights and ideas.

How do you connect to your characters?
I get into colleen's head space, I imagine that I'm in the Last of Us universe. Even in the moments of calm, there is always an underlying threat.

What is the biggest challenge about performing in this show?
The music. I love the songs, but they are hard! It's no Music Man, that's for sure!

What motivates your character?
colleen is a survivor, so she is motivated by basic needs. She makes decisions to keep herself and her group safe, fed etc. That said, she will also be ready to drop anyone who is a dead weight.

Without giving anything away, what is your favorite line of dialogue?
"He discovers he's s**tting his pants"

Besides yourself, which actor in this production is going to blow people away?
Karis blows me away every time.

If you could play any other role in the show, who would it be?
Maria.
